• Ласкаво просимо на Спільнота для обміну досвідом між користувачами програм УкрБланк, УкрСклад, УкрЗарплата.
 

Интернет-магазин OpenCart и УкрСклад

Автор admin, Листопад 13, 2012, 15:45:57

Попередня тема - Наступна тема

0 Користувачі і 12 Гостей дивляться цю тему.

SergZP

С какой версией ОпенКарт работает модуль синхронизации?

admin

Цитата: SergZP від Січень 31, 2018, 20:04:23
С какой версией ОпенКарт работает модуль синхронизации?

Любая стабильная версия желательно последние, лучше ocStore т.к. есть главная категория.
https://www.softbalance.com.ua/forum/index.php/topic,2520.msg25167.html#msg25167
https://www.softbalance.com.ua/forum/index.php/topic,2520.msg24892.html#msg24892

Ckoll

У кого-то есть актуальная инструкция по настройке синхронизации программы с Opencart? Та, что в архиве не совпадает с интерфейсом программы. Даже методом тыка не удалось найти упомянутые пункты.

admin

Цитата: Ckoll від Лютий 12, 2018, 12:13:44
У кого-то есть актуальная инструкция по настройке синхронизации программы с Opencart? Та, что в архиве не совпадает с интерфейсом программы. Даже методом тыка не удалось найти упомянутые пункты.

Инструкция вроде актуальная. Пожалуйста, укажите точно какой именно упомянутый пункт из инструкции, вы не нашли методом тыка?

admin

#814
Период бета-тестирования закончился, теперь программу синхронизации можно купить.

УкрСклад Синхронизация с Интернет магазином 2.0 (16.02.2018)
----------------------------------------------------------------------------
- Переработана синхронизация групп товаров, сейчас строиться полная иерархия групп, позволяет синхронизировать сложные и повторяющиеся цепочки групп.
- Добавлена очистка папки \Windows\Temp\, после выхода из программы.
- Добавлена синхронизация счетов из OpenCart в УкрСклад по последней метке, т.е. программа не будет каждый раз запрашивать весь список счетов при каждой синхронизации.
- Теперь документы Счет-фактора, Расходная накладная и ПКО, объединяются в группу документов.
- Добавлена детализация ошибок PDO MySQL.
- Добавлено уведомление пользователя при ошибке загрузки фото, обычно проблема в размере рисунка.
- Добавлена проверка одинаковых подгрупп товаров в группе, в одной группе не должно быть двух одинаковых групп.
- Добавлено ограничение на запуск нескольких копий программы одновременно, что приводило к путанице и ошибкам.
- Добавлена проверка версии УкрСклада, иногда пользователи работали на очень старых версиях что приводило к ошибкам.
- Доработано: поиск товара для документа, ранее проходил только по наименованию, сейчас по внутреннему ID и только после по наименованию.
- Исправлено: иногда Баланс Клиента не исправлялся при синхронизации заказов.
- Исправлена ошибка с нулевыми суммами в расходной накладной
- Исправлено: неверно выставлялся main_pid при добавлении клиента из OpenCart.
- Исправлена проблема синхронизации описания группы, при первом обмене с OpenCart в УкрСклад.
- Исправлена ошибка в определении ID склада, могли браться группы из других складов.
- Исправлено: для Групп товаров и Товаров иногда могли синхронизироваться удаленные записи.

Программу "УкрСклад: Синхронизация с Интернет магазином" можно скачать по ссылке:
http://www.ukrsklad.com/files/sklad_im.rar
В архиве есть справка, файл sklad_im.pdf, обязательно прочитайте.

eleo

Подскажите, а старый файл site/ukrsklad_inc/opencart.php можно не заменять? В нём были произведены изменения?
Просто в нашем файле opencart.php было внесено множество изменений, которые затрутся, если заменить его из новой версии.

admin

Цитата: eleo від Лютий 19, 2018, 14:11:17
Подскажите, а старый файл site/ukrsklad_inc/opencart.php можно не заменять?

Нет, замена обязательная. Если вы делали изменения в файле, вы должны обязательно учитывать эти изменения в новой версии файла opencart.php.

Denvik

Добрый день, подскажите пожалуйста в чем может быть причина, при синхронизации данных с опенкарта в документах нет единиц измирения?

admin

Цитата: Denvik від Лютий 19, 2018, 17:51:53
Добрый день, подскажите пожалуйста в чем может быть причина, при синхронизации данных с опенкарта в документах нет единиц измирения?

Напишите на поддержку, проверим.

FEODAJI

Добрый день.
Подскажите пожалуйста, как можно изменить приоритетность языков при синхронизации Укрсклад и Опенкарт, ситуация такая: когда в программе синхронизации нажимаю Информация о сайте выдает следующее:

Язык(language):
1=Русский
3=Українська

Далее при синхронизации данных, в карточке товара на сайте, есть два раздела ( на украинском и русском языке), первым стоит украинский язык, и все названия в укрскладе тоже на украинском, но при синхронизации бросает во вкладку русского языка.
Как можно изменить приоритетность языка?
Спасибо


admin

#820
Цитата: FEODAJI від Лютий 23, 2018, 21:25:19
Добрый день.
Подскажите пожалуйста, как можно изменить приоритетность языков при синхронизации Укрсклад и Опенкарт, ситуация такая: когда в программе синхронизации нажимаю Информация о сайте выдает следующее:

Язык(language):
1=Русский
3=Українська

Далее при синхронизации данных, в карточке товара на сайте, есть два раздела ( на украинском и русском языке), первым стоит украинский язык, и все названия в укрскладе тоже на украинском, но при синхронизации бросает во вкладку русского языка.
Как можно изменить приоритетность языка?
Спасибо

Из справки:
https://www.softbalance.com.ua/help/sklad_im.html#настройка-скриптов

//OpenCard

define('MAIN_LANG_ID', '1'); // ID языка в OpenCart, можно посмотреть список ID через прорамму кнопкой "Информация о сайте"
define('SEC_LANG_ID', '-1'); // ID дополнительного языка в OpenCart, если используется один язык, оставьте параметр '-1'


Вам скорее всего надо:
define('MAIN_LANG_ID', '3');
define('SEC_LANG_ID', '1');

Maruyta

Здравствуйте.  Пробую бета-версию 1.45 бета от 04.10.2017. При добавлении и синхронизации всем товарам на сайте ставит дату 2007-01-01, а в программе дата создания товара 03.02.2017 17:56:03. В чем может быть причина?

admin

Цитата: Maruyta від Березень 05, 2018, 21:48:22
Здравствуйте.  Пробую бета-версию 1.45 бета от 04.10.2017. При добавлении и синхронизации всем товарам на сайте ставит дату 2007-01-01, а в программе дата создания товара 03.02.2017 17:56:03. В чем может быть причина?

Какую именно дату ставит?  Скрипт синхронизации, параметр "date_added"(дата добавления) ставит текущую:
date_added = NOW()
а параметр date_available (дата доступно с) ставит действительно 2007-01-01
date_available = '2007-01-01'

Зачем именно параметр date_available (дата доступно с) ставить другой?

Maruyta

Какую именно дату ставит?  Скрипт синхронизации, параметр "date_added"(дата добавления) ставит текущую:
Код: [Выделить]
date_added = NOW()
а параметр date_available (дата доступно с) ставит действительно 2007-01-01
Код: [Выделить]
date_available = '2007-01-01'

Зачем именно параметр date_available (дата доступно с) ставить другой?


А где надо менять?

admin

Цитата: Maruyta від Березень 06, 2018, 16:28:46
А где надо менять?

То что мы выше описали, это в файле ukrsklad_inc/opencart.php.